It lets you lay content out in rows and columns, and has many features that make building complex layouts straightforward. GridsĬSS Grid Layout is a two-dimensional layout system for the web. After studying this guide you can test your flexbox skills to check your understanding before moving on. This article explains all the fundamentals. Items flex to fill additional space and shrink to fit into smaller spaces. ![]() Flexboxįlexbox is a one-dimensional layout method for laying out items in rows or columns. This article explains the basics of normal flow as a grounding for learning how to change it. Normal flowĮlements on webpages lay themselves out according to normal flow - until we do something to change that.
